java类是什么意思

Java类是Java编程语言中面向对象编程的基础,它是一种用户自定义的数据类型,可以包含数据成员(变量)和操作成员(方法)。通过创建类的实例(对象),可以具体使用类中定义的变量和方法。

Java类指的是一种面向对象编程中的基本构成模块,用于描述具有相同属性和行为的对象的集合,在Java中,类是创建对象的模板,它定义了一类对象的属性和行为。

java类是什么意思
(图片来源网络,侵删)

为了更全面理解Java类的概念,可以从以下几个方面进行分析:

1、类与对象的关系

类是对客观世界中一类具有共同特征和行为的事物的抽象,所有的学生可以抽象为一个“学生”类,它们有共同的特征(如姓名、年龄)和行为(如学习)。

对象则是类的实例,即具体的存在,一个具体的学生张三就是“学生”类的一个对象。

2、类的定义结构

java类是什么意思
(图片来源网络,侵删)

Java中的类由成员变量、方法和构造方法组成,成员变量定义了对象的属性,例如字符串名字 (String name);方法定义了对象的行为,例如显示名字 (public void showName())。

每个类还有构造方法,用于创建类的实例,构造方法的名称与类名相同,并且没有返回值类型,一个“Dog”类的构造方法可以是 public Dog()。

3、类的实现细节

类可以包含不同的变量类型:局部变量、成员变量和类变量(静态变量),局部变量在方法内定义,作用范围仅限于该方法;成员变量在类中定义,适用于所有对象;类变量在类中使用 static 关键字声明,属于整个类。

方法可以包括普通方法和构造方法,构造方法用于初始化新对象的状态,而普通方法执行特定的操作。

java类是什么意思
(图片来源网络,侵删)

4、类的实例化过程

通过使用 new 关键字和构造方法来创建类的实例,创建“Dog”类的对象可以使用 Dog myDog = new Dog();。

在实例化过程中,会自动调用相应的构造方法来初始化对象的属性。

5、类的实践应用

类的设计和应用是面向对象程序设计的基础,通过精心设计的类,可以有效组织代码,提高代码的复用性和可维护性。

在实际项目中,合理定义和使用类及其方法是实现功能和逻辑的核心步骤。

Java类是面向对象编程的基础,理解其概念和使用方式对于掌握Java至关重要,类作为对象的模板,定义了对象的属性和行为,是代码组织和复用的基本单位,通过深入理解类的机制和实际应用,开发者可以编写出更加高效、可维护的代码。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/768779.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-07-11 07:46
下一篇 2024-07-11

相关推荐

  • 如何理解JavaScript中的类定义和面向对象编程?

    在JavaScript中,类是一种面向对象编程的构造,它允许我们创建具有相同属性和方法的对象。我们可以使用class关键字来定义一个类,然后在类中定义构造函数和各种方法。

    2024-09-02
    016
  • new操作符_操作符,如何有效应用这种编程构造?

    new操作符在JavaScript中用于创建一个新的对象实例。当你使用new关键字调用一个函数时,它执行以下步骤:,,1. 创建一个新的空对象。,2. 将这个空对象的原型设置为构造函数的prototype属性。,3. 将这个空对象作为this的上下文,调用构造函数。,4. 如果构造函数没有返回自己的对象,那么返回这个新对象。,,这样,通过new操作符可以实例化一个特定构造函数定义的对象类型。

    2024-08-17
    022
  • new操作符具体干了什么

    在JavaScript中,new操作符用于创建一个对象的实例。它首先创建了一个空对象,然后将该对象的原型设置为构造函数的prototype对象,最后调用构造函数,将this指向新对象,并执行函数体。

    2024-07-10
    036
  • new操作符返回什么

    new操作符在JavaScript中用于创建一个对象的实例。它调用一个构造函数,并返回一个新创建的对象实例。

    2024-07-10
    071

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入